Description

Explore the evolving landscape of educational architecture and teaching methods with Design, Education and Pedagogy by Routledge. This book examines the rise of large, flexible spaces within schools and universities that utilize modern design principles and new technologies. As educational institutions change, a new vocabulary has emerged to describe these environments. The text covers the development of modern learning environments, innovative learning environments, and flexible learning environments. It also addresses the rise of new generation learning spaces. By looking at how these facilities are built and used, the book provides insight into the connection between physical space and the educational experience. This is an essential resource for those studying how contemporary design impacts the way students and teachers interact in academic settings.
